summaryrefslogtreecommitdiff
path: root/src
AgeCommit message (Expand)Author
2022-08-11Fix buffer overrun in FontFileMakeDir on WIN32Peter Harris
2022-06-21Fix comments to reflect removal of OS/2 supportAlan Coopersmith
2022-06-21Correct fsCreateACReq lengthJeremy Huddleston Sequoia
2022-04-06Fix spelling/wording issuesAlan Coopersmith
2021-07-14Fix out-of-bounds read in FontFileMakeDir()Alex Richardson
2021-03-02Fix use after free when font server connection lostPeter Harris
2020-03-06Fix crash when font server connection lostPeter Harris
2019-10-25Fix Win32 build since c4ed2e06 "Add some unit testing utilities"Jon Turney
2019-08-17fs_read_glyphs: check if rep is null before dereferencingAlan Coopersmith
2019-08-17CatalogueRescan: if opendir() fails, unref fpes, but don't free the catAlan Coopersmith
2019-08-17ComputeScaledProperties: check for valid pointers before making atomsAlan Coopersmith
2019-08-17stubs/atom.c: check for ResizeHashTable failureAlan Coopersmith
2019-08-17Fix whitespaceMaya Rashish
2019-08-04fontxlfd.c: tell gcc that switch fallthrough is intentionalAlan Coopersmith
2019-08-04Convert multiplying malloc calls to use mallocarray insteadAlan Coopersmith
2019-08-03Convert multiplying realloc calls to use reallocarray insteadAlan Coopersmith
2019-08-03Add reallocarray fallback if not provided by libc nor libbsdAlan Coopersmith
2019-08-03Use bounds checking string functions everywhereAlan Coopersmith
2019-08-03Add strlcat & strlcpy fallbacks if not provided by libc nor libbsdAlan Coopersmith
2018-03-24avoid -Wformat errors from clang when building with -DDEBUGRin Okuyama
2017-11-25Open files with O_NOFOLLOW. (CVE-2017-16611)Michal Srb
2017-10-04pcfGetProperties: Check string boundaries (CVE-2017-13722)Michal Srb
2017-10-04Check for end of string in PatternMatch (CVE-2017-13720)Michal Srb
2016-06-10freetype: Fix a logic error in computing face nameAdam Jackson
2016-05-30fserve: Fix a buffer read overrun in _fs_client_accessJeremy Huddleston Sequoia
2016-05-30fstrans: Remove unused foo() functionJeremy Huddleston Sequoia
2016-05-29fserve: Silence a -Wformat warningJeremy Huddleston Sequoia
2016-05-29bitmap: Bail out on invalid input to FontFileMakeDir instead of calling callo...Jeremy Huddleston Sequoia
2016-05-29FreeType: Correct an allocation sizeJeremy Huddleston Sequoia
2015-12-09Convert to non-recursive build.Matt Turner
2015-12-08Eliminate calls back to X server or font server functions by name (v4)libXfont2-2.0.0Keith Packard
2015-12-08Add compiler warning flags and fix warningsKeith Packard
2015-10-21Use NO_WEAK_SYMBOLS instead of -flat_namespaceJeremy Huddleston Sequoia
2015-10-21stubs: Add missing externs for declarations in the NO_WEAK_SYMBOLS && PIC stu...Jeremy Huddleston Sequoia
2015-10-20Fix is*() usage.Thomas Klausner
2015-07-28bdfReadCharacters: Allow negative DWIDTH valuesBenjamin Tissoires
2015-03-17bdfReadCharacters: ensure metrics fit into xCharInfo struct [CVE-2015-1804]Alan Coopersmith
2015-03-17bdfReadCharacters: bailout if a char's bitmap cannot be read [CVE-2015-1803]Alan Coopersmith
2015-03-17bdfReadProperties: property count needs range check [CVE-2015-1802]Alan Coopersmith
2015-02-26Set close-on-exec for font file I/O.Christos Zoulas
2014-11-05Use 'imdent' to realign cpp indentation levels in fslibos.hAlan Coopersmith
2014-11-05Remove unneeded checks for #ifndef X_NOT_POSIXAlan Coopersmith
2014-06-27Make shared library work on Cygwin/MinGWYaakov Selkowitz
2014-05-23Use default glyphs when getting 16-bit font with 8-bit textKeith Packard
2014-05-23Don't build unused code in bitmapfunc.c if all bitmap formats are disabledAlan Coopersmith
2014-05-23Don't compile bitmap source files for disabled formatsAlan Coopersmith
2014-05-23Drop imake/monolithic compatibility #define mappingAlan Coopersmith
2014-05-12CVE-2014-0210: unvalidated length fields in fs_read_list_info()Alan Coopersmith
2014-05-12CVE-2014-0210: unvalidated length fields in fs_read_list()Alan Coopersmith
2014-05-12CVE-2014-0210: unvalidated length fields in fs_read_glyphs()Alan Coopersmith